Jobs Career Advice Signup

Send this job to a friend


Did you notice an error or suspect this job is scam? Tell us.

  • Posted: May 13, 2021
    Deadline: Not specified
  • Impact is transforming the way enterprises manage and optimize all types of partnerships. Our Partnership CloudTM is an integrated end-to-end solution for managing an enterprises partnerships across the entire partner lifecycle to activate rapid growth through the emerging Partnership Economy.Impact was founded in 2008 by a team of Internet marketing and ...
    Read more about this company


    Senior Full Stack Engineer

    Your Role at Impact:

    • As Senior Full Stack Engineer you will work on the Affluent SaaS Platform where you will drive and take ownership of various technologies to build features which will enable large-scale processing of data to support the Impact platform.
    • You will form part of an Agile / Scrum team where you will mentor squad members. This role assumes a certain independent capability to investigate and learn new technologies for the platform. 

    What You'll Do:

    • Review business needs, design, implement, test and perform code review for various features for the Impact Platform
    • Gain and maintain a deep understanding of the business and product domain to deliver effective solutions
    • Provide transparency through daily Scrums, Kanban (or similar)
    • Identify, raise and address system vulnerabilities and technology blockers for the squad
    • Optimize code and streamline processes to improve performance and platform stability and reduce overall system load
    • Review error messages and fix bugs in a timely manner
    • Work in a distributed and agile environment
    • Responsible for continuous improvement of developer productivity

    What You Have:

    • Bachelor in Computer Science or similar field of study
    • 3+ years in a similar role
    • 3+ years experience working on Enterprise Solutions using NodeJS (essential)
    • 3+ years experience working with Eclipse, IntelliJ, Application Servers, WebServices, Data Management Systems (essential)
    • 3+ years experience with SQL and database development, familiarity with Data Modeling concepts
    • 3+ years experience in Full Stack development, including front-end, back-end and databases
    • 3+ years experience with JavaScript and Front-end technologies
    • 3+ years experience working with Large Data Volumes and distributed systems (advantageous)
    • 3+ years experience working in a Start-up or Internet business (advantageous)
    • Familiarity with Web Services (REST or SOAP)
    • Github Account w/ showcased work / samples / contributions


    • Unlimited PTO policy
    • Take the time off that you need. We are truly committed to a positive work-life balance, recognising that it is important to be happy and fulfilled in both
    • Training & Development
    • Learning the advanced partnership automation products
    • Medical Aid and Provident Fund 
    • Group schemes with Discovery & Bonitas for medical aid
    • Group scheme with Momentum for provident fund
    • Stock Options
    • 4-year vesting schedule pending Board approval
    • Internet Allowance
    • Flexible work hours
    • Casual work environment

    Method of Application

    Interested and qualified? Go to Impact on to apply

    Note: Never pay for any training, certificate, assessment, or testing to the recruiter.

  • Send your application

    View All Vacancies at Impact Back To Home

Career Advice

View All Career Advice

Subscribe to Job Alert


Join our happy subscribers

Send your application through

YahoomailYahoomail GmailGmail Hotmail Hotmail